Discovering Lleida’s Hidden Lakeside Villages: The New ‘Turistren Passport’ and Tren dels Llacs

May 29, 2026
Discovering Lleida’s Hidden Lakeside Villages: The New 'Turistren Passport' and Tren dels Llacs

As the world continues to embrace slow tourism, the Pyrenees region of Spain, specifically Catalonia, is taking significant strides to enhance its offerings. The highly anticipated return of the Tren dels Llacs for the 2026 season marks a vital development in this tourist-friendly initiative. This scenic train will whisk travelers through 29 captivating rides across the picturesque beauty of the Catalan Pre-Pyrenees, connecting Lleida to La Pobla de Segur, and guiding visitors to explore its charming lakeside villages.

Covering a distance of around 89 kilometers, the Tren dels Llacs journey lasts approximately two hours, showcasing breathtaking views of rivers, valleys, and striking mountain landscapes. With its unique route that involves traveling through tunnels and crossing 75 bridges, this experience stands out as one of Catalonia’s premier rail tourism adventures.

Embark on a Scenic Journey Through Catalonia’s Natural Wonders

The Tren dels Llacs route embarks from Lleida, making its way northward toward La Pobla de Segur. Along this route, riders are treated to some of Catalonia’s most stunning inland vistas. The Pre-Pyrenees—which combines remarkable scenery, cultural history, and traditional communities—beckons travelers to immerse themselves in its surroundings.

This unique rail journey highlights three major stops, each with its own attractions: La Pobla de Segur, Salàs de Pallars, and Tremp. These points of interest not only invite visitors to discover local history and delectable gastronomic offerings but also provide ample opportunities for outdoor activities.

La Pobla de Segur serves as a gateway to the enchanting mountain landscape, appealing to nature enthusiasts and hiking aficionados. Meanwhile, Salàs de Pallars offers a window into traditional Catalan culture, and Tremp enchants visitors with its sweeping landscapes that connect to the broader Pallars region.

To enrich the travel experience, each train ride includes an onboard guide who shares insightful information about the area’s history, culture, and geography. This storytelling aspect transforms the journey into a meaningful educational outing, allowing travelers to forge a deeper understanding of the region they are exploring.

Choosing Between a Historic Journey and a Panoramic Experience

The 2026 season of Tren dels Llacs introduces two distinct travel options that cater to different preferences. The Historic Train service operates on Saturdays, featuring 23 journeys until June 27 and then again from August 22 to October 31. This service is ideal for those yearning for an authentic experience of earlier railway adventures, complete with vintage trains that evoke a sense of nostalgia.

This historic format resonates with railway enthusiasts, families, and cultural explorers who appreciate heritage tourism. It underscores the role of trains not just as modes of transport but as vital elements of Catalonia’s cultural identity and history.

For those seeking a more visual encounter, the Panoramic Train will offer six departures between July 4 and August 8. With larger windows designed to capture the essence of the stunning landscapes throughout the journey, this service will be perfect for photographers and nature lovers alike.

By providing both historic and panoramic options, Tren dels Llacs positions itself as a versatile destination that can cater to various traveler interests—from culture and history aficionados to adventure seekers and photographers.

Sustainable Tourism Takes Center Stage in Europe

The resurgence of the Tren dels Llacs is part of a larger European movement prioritizing sustainable and leisurely travel. Scenic rail experiences like this are gaining immense popularity as more travelers look for methods to reduce their environmental impact while forging meaningful connections with their destinations.

Trips like these encourage exploration of local regions beyond the major urban centers, substantially benefiting smaller communities through increased tourism spending in restaurants, cultural sites, and local experiences. The economic boost provided by Tren dels Llacs supports the growth of vital tourism infrastructures in these rural areas.

Additionally, the flexible ticketing options enhance the overall travel experience, allowing passengers to return to Lleida using a conventional train within six days. This encourages longer stays in the region, providing ample time to enjoy various attractions in the beautiful Pre-Pyrenees.

For Catalonia, this train route is more than just a travel experience; it offers a chance to shine a light on lesser-known yet breathtaking destinations while promoting responsible tourism strategies.
